**Runbook: Account recovery — Wavetrace preview service**

If a maintainer loses access to the Wavetrace account that renders audio waveform previews, do not recreate it; the render queue is bound to that identity. Steps: pause the preview workers, confirm queue drain, then initiate recovery from the admin node. Recovery requires the stored passphrase, not the daily credentials. Skipping the drain step corrupts in-flight waveform tiles. Once drained, enter the passphrase at the prompt. The passphrase is recorded on the next line.

recovery phrase for fajep-yaweg: gilath-sorox-wenius-rusdor-keliel-zorius

## Rate-parity checker: plugin setup

Scope: Tallow-Parity service only. Plugins run sandboxed; no direct DB access. Poll the comparison queue, emit mismatch events, exit cleanly. Rate snapshots older than 20 minutes are discarded — do not retry them. Crawl budgets are enforced per property group; exceeding them gets your plugin throttled for an hour. Your plugin must load the runtime settings shown below before registering.

service settings:
[casax]
port = 6379
team = rusir
host = casax.zemvarhq.corp
region = outer-4
access_code = ac_9808ce
timeout_ms = 1500

Ticket: Sproutline vault locked — plugin publishing halted. The Dewfall credential vault sealed itself after last night's rotation, so plugin authors can't push watering-schedule extensions to the Sproutline registry. Validation hooks still run locally; only publish is blocked. Workaround: none. Plugin signing resumes once the vault is unsealed. Unseal with the recovery passphrase noted directly beneath this ticket.

unlock words, hahip-baduf: holwyn-istath-julvan

Subject: Date localization cut-over complete

Team,

As of last night, Fablenote renders all dates through the new locale service instead of the hardcoded formatter. Regional formats now follow the user's profile locale, with a sensible fallback chain. Legacy format strings were removed from the templates. For future reference, the locale service currently runs with the configuration shown below.

settings of fajog-kajof:
julwyn:
  pin: 0480
  tenant: rusok
  seal: seal_456f5567
  metrics_host: metrics.julwyn.qirvangrid.local
  standby_team: rusath
  escalation: eliael-jorax
  nonce: ca9746